All in on know your breed. When i got my first pup after college i read the dog breed books, chose 5 to consider, went to dog shows and talked to owners snd breeders in depth and then visited a few. It was an invaluable exercise for me.

My first i got from a litter in Hungary through a connection at Andrews Air Force Base. Fortunately re-socialization was basically retraining and doing it right with one i had from the start.

Hungary Kuvasz. Viszlas are hunting dogs. Kuvasz were sheep guarding dogs primarily for wolves and bears.

Puli’s were the herding dogs. Komondors were also sheep guarding dogs. Komondors are big dogs with whiteish dreadlock coats. Pulis are smaller w black dreadlock coats.

Had a scare last night, fortunately all was well. Never knew this about toads/frogs and dogs. https://equipawspetservices.com/was-you ... revention/

This was the fella that starting the foaming come out of my pups mouth....lasted about 15-20 minutes. Used a couple towels to wipe her gums, teeth, and everywhere in her mouth....then flushed with the house for quite some time, trying to avoid here drinking. Stressful evening.
